Sporting Charleroi form and stats

Sporting Charleroi have played 10 Pro League games at their own stadium so far this season, resulting in 4-2-4 (wins-draws-losses).

Stress levels are on the rise for Charleroi's attacking players as they have now played 221 minutes without scoring in a league game. Nicholson was their last goal scorer.

In their previous game, the manager Still led his Sporting Charleroi to a defeat in the Pro League match away at Antwerp. The manager is hoping to put things right immediately here at Stade du Pays de Charleroi. The gifted forward Gholizadeh bested all the other players in that game and got a match rating of 7.23 out of 10. Gholizadeh hit one key pass and had 40 successful passes (of 48 total).

Preceding that match was a defeat to OH Leuven (0-3).

Another home game is coming up fairly shortly for the hosts, as Kortrijk are coming to town in three days.

Sporting Charleroi has scored 13 league goals at home this season, in 10 matches. Sporting Charleroi have conceded 12 in these home matches. It's worth mentioning that 6 of these goals has been conceded in their last three home matches.

Gent form and stats

3-3-5 is the win-draw-loss statistic for Gent in their Pro League matches away.

Gent's last game was the home draw against Kortrijk (2-2). Midfield player Kums was the top player of the team with a match rating of 8.44/10. Kums hit four key passes, dribled past the opponent 1 of 1 times and had 75 successful passes (of 82 total).

A 0-0 draw at Union Saint-Gilloise's stadium before that.

After this away game Gent return home for a Pro League game against KV Oostende. That game is only three sleeps after this.

Scoring goals is the main ingredient in creating success in football, and not only at home. So far Gent have scored 11 goals in 11 league games away. As opposed to that, Gent have seen the ball go into their own net 11 times on the road.

Head 2 Head

Gent - Sporting Charleroi 2-3 was the product when these sides formerly did battle, earlier this season. Last ten meetings with these contenders: Sporting Charleroi won five, Gent triumphed in four and we saw one draw. five games with over 2,5 goals, five matches with less than 2,5 goals.

The First Division A is the top league of the football pyramid in Belgium, founded in 1895. It was earlier known as the Belgian Pro League. The season runs from July to May with 16 teams each playing 30 fixtures. The top six in the league table then play a championship playoff, the bottom team is relegated and places #7 to #15 have a Europa League playoff.
